Although there is no official medical consensus of what level of folate in blood serum indicates a deficiency most practitioners agree that a level of less than seven nanomols per liter 7nmolL is problematic. Folate deficiency can be confirmed with a normal B12 and MMA level and elevated homocysteine levels while vitamin B12 deficiency can be confirmed with elevated MMA and homocysteine levels and low B12 levels 1.
